Does everybody in the house have to work?

0

As a principle, all adult household members will be required to work. There will be documented exceptions to this, such as those suffering from certain disabilities. All requests for exceptions will be considered on an individual basis by the Membership Committee. Please do remember, however, that one of primary ways a co-operative can provide members with groceries at a lower price than you would be able to get elsewhere because of the lower expenses that work shifts allow us to achieve. All of the savings are passed on to members, and as such, we ask that all members participate fully and honestly in the running of the organization.
